Description

Purpose of Your Job Position


The primary purpose of your position is to provide direct nursing care to the residents, and to supervise the day-to-day nursing activities performed by CNAs/GNAs and other nursing personnel.

To monitor the performance of CNAs/GNAs, nursing and non-licensed personnel, provide education and counseling, perform disciplinary action as necessary, and complete performance evaluations.

Such supervision must be in accordance with current federal, state, and local standards, guidelines, and regulations that govern our Facility, and as may be required by the Director of Nursing Services or Nurse Supervisor to ensure that the highest degree of quality care is maintained at all times.


Delegation of Authority


As Licensed Practical Nurse/Registered Nurse you are delegated the administrative authority, responsibility, and accountability necessary for carrying out your assigned duties.

Duties and Responsibilities

Administrative Functions

  • Direct the daytoday functions of the CNAs/GNAs or other nursing personnel in accordance with current rules, regulations, and guidelines that govern the longterm care Facility.
  • Ensure that all assigned nursing personnel including CNAs/GNAs comply with the written policies and procedures established by this Facility.
  • Periodically review the department's policies, procedure manuals, job descriptions, etc. Make recommendations for revisions.
  • Provide discipline and evaluations of assigned CNAs/GNAs and other nursing personnel in accordance with current rules, regulations, and guidelines that govern the Facility.
  • Issue verbal and written disciplinary warnings to assigned CNAs/GNAs and other nursing personnel for violations of current rules, regulations, and guidelines of the Facility.
  • Meet with your assigned nursing personnel, including CNAs/GNAs, as well as support personnel, in planning the shifts' services, programs, and activities.
  • Ensure that the Nursing Service Procedures Manual is current and reflects the daytoday nursing procedures performed in the Facility.
  • Ensure that all nursing service personnel comply with the procedures set forth in the Nursing Service Procedures Manual.
  • Make written and oral reports or recommendations concerning the activities of your shift, as required.
  • Cooperate with other resident services when coordinating nursing services to ensure that the resident's total regimen of care is maintained.
  • Ensure that all nursing service personnel comply with their respective job descriptions.
  • Participate in the maintenance and implementation of the Facility's quality assurance program for the nursing service department.
  • Participate in Facility surveys or inspections made by authorized government agencies, as may be requested.
  • Periodically review the resident's written discharge plan. Participate in the updating of the resident's written discharge plan, as required.
  • Assist in planning the nursing services portion of the resident's discharge plan, as necessary.
  • Interpret the department's policies and procedures to personnel, residents, visitors, and government agencies, as required.
  • Admit, transfer, and discharge residents, as required.
  • Complete accident and incident reports, as necessary.
  • Write resident charge slips and forward to the Business Office.
  • Perform administrative duties such as completing medical forms, reports, evaluations, studies, charting, etc., as necessary.

Charting and Documentation

  • Complete and file required recordkeeping forms or charts upon the resident's admission, transfer, and/or discharge.
  • Encourage attending physicians to review treatment plans, record and sign their orders, progress notes, etc., in accordance with established policies.
  • Receive telephone orders from physicians and record on the Physicians' Order Form.
  • Transcribe physician's orders to resident charts, cardex, medication cards, treatment or care plans, as required.
  • Chart nurses' notes in an informative and descriptive manner that reflects the care provided to the resident, as well as the resident's response to the care.
  • Fill out and complete accident and incident reports. Submit to Director of Nursing, as required.
  • Chart all reports of accidents and incidents involving residents. Follow established procedures.
  • Record new and changed diet orders. Forward information to the Food Services Department.
  • Report all discrepancies noted concerning physician's orders, diet change, charting error, etc., to the Nurse Supervisor and/or Unit Manger.
